Transaction 03d45362e00bc64acf5edfe684a37390fc8996139b5d48e99cc4dc5d22639e91
1 Input
1 Output
-
03d45362e00bc64acf5edfe684a37390fc8996139b5d48e99cc4dc5d22639e91:0
- value
- 2050224
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b167dec839470ff8bd1ace48ca30cd7d8f15caa9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HB32z8S7JzNPTx5mZEuUcNtYnvwEXeZJT